Manager Transformation
Reports to: Sr Director Transformation
Job Summary: Manager TMO provides hands-on support to the Senior Director of Transformation VP of Transformation VP of Planning and VP of GTM. Specific responsibilities include oversight and cross-functional implementation of transition workstreams support on required tool development i.e. digital product creation tools (e.g. DAM PLM) and other transformation workstreams and special projects (e.g. global reporting AI & GenAI Acceleration etc.) depending on TMO priorities.
How You Will Make a Difference:
- Workstream Coordination Transition Workstreams
- Identify risks and interdependencies between multiple transformation workstreams; assess type of risk and develop mitigation strategies with Senior Director
- Oversee tracking and execution of transition workstreams ensuring smooth handover to business-as-usual (e.g. Stores Brand Marketing)
- Conduct ongoing monitoring and tracking of milestone completion with initiative owners
- Report progress on milestones and provide weekly updates to the Senior Director
- Facilitate regular meeting check-ins and email updates with sponsors as per agreed cadence
- Collaborate with VF Finance and workstream leads to ensure value realization is on track
- Coordinate risk assessments and escalate execution challenges as needed
- Workstream Execution e.g. go-to-market support integrated business planning marketing effectiveness AI & GenAI Acceleration
- Work with business teams across functions brands regions to ensure creation and adoption of new tools / processes core to the successful business and planning transformatione.g. support in workshops gather feedback from users iterate on templates and track implementation progress
- Support rollout of new tools and systems on ad-hoc basis by trouble shooting identifying gaps in usability/functionality creating standardized templates identifying business needs etc.
- Project manage implementation incl. meeting and materials preparation communication on progress to leadership identification and addressing of roadblocks together with the Sr Director of Transformation
- Support the preparation of materials to present progress and updates to the global leadership team
- Create training materials and support VF Academies to enable change management
- Special Projects e.g. Digital Product Creation Global Reporting etc.
- Oversee and provide ad-hoc support to build specific tools related to digital transformatione.g. PLM DAM and Materials Toolkit
- Depending on project assigned coordinate with cross-functional teams (IT Digital Marketing Finance) to ensure alignment on digital enablement initiatives.
- Assist in the development and update of critical reporting dashboards ensuring alignment with commercial teams

Qualifications & Experience:
- Degree in related field preferred; Masters degree preferred
- Minimum 5 years of related experience in consumer-centric fast-moving companies.
- Experience driving strategic and operational activities for a transformation office or PMO team within a global organization
- Preferred: Experience driving cost or digital programs ideally in the apparel/footwear/fashion industry
- Preferred: experience in planning merchandising and/or buying
Hiring Range:
$112320.00 USD - $140400.00 USD annually
